Phonosemantic compound. 人 represents the meaning and 京 represents the sound. Depicts a person (人) in a high place (京).

說文解字
《說文》:“麗,旅行也。鹿之性見食急則必旅行。从鹿,丽聲。《禮》‘麗皮納聘’,蓋鹿皮也。,古文;,篆文麗字。”
